06-10-17, 05:04 PM
(06-10-17, 11:23 AM)Adrees كتب : اخي الكريم
في هذه الحالة دعنا نتعامل مع الاشتراكات وكانها عملية بيع صنف او سلعة معينة
على سبيل المثال عند تسجيل اشتراك لعميل محدد سيكون كالتالي :
فاتورة اشتراك وتتكون من :
رقم الفاتورة
تاريخ الفاتورة
اسم الخدمة
الاشتراك لشهر
اسم العميل
قيمة الاشتراك
المبلغ المدفوع
---------------------------------------
الآن تحتاج الى انشاء جدول العمليات ويتكون من الآتي :
الرقم
رقم الفاتورة
تاريخ الفاتورة
رقم الخدمة
الشهر
قيمة الاشتراك
المبلغ المدفوع
----------------------------------------
طريقة العمل
قم بحفظ بيانات الفاتورة في جدول العمليات
وفي حال لم دفع العميل المبلغ سيسجل المبلغ المدفوع بالقيمة 0
وعند الاستعلام عن الذين لم يدفعوا خلال شهر محدد
ستكتب قم بجلب كافة العملاء الذين يساوي المبلغ الدفوع الخاص بهم 0 خلال شهر اكتوبر مثلاً.
هذه محاولة متواضعة مني آمل ان تساعدك.
أولًا: جزاك الله خيرًا على مشاركتك
ولكن لي ملحوظة خاصة بطريقة العمل:
هل هذا يعني أنه سوف يكون هناك فاتورة لكل شهر
ولو كان الأمر كذلك فإنه سوف يكون من الصعب جدًا أن تقوم في كل شهر بسؤال كل عميل هل سوف تشترك في هذا الشهر أم لا ثم بعد ذلك تقوم بعمل فاتورة له خاصة إذا كان عدد العملاء كبير جدًا
ولو قلنا نضيف فواتير لجميع العملاء في بداية كل شهر دون سؤالهم قد يكون حل مناسب لو كانت الإضافة بطريقة آلية وفي تلك الحالة أحتاج الكود اللازم لعمل ذلك.

